Page 663 - 3-3
P. 663

elif password_input==False:
                      #NFC   태그로 입력된 값일 경우


                              status_reason_input('waiting','')
                              # 대기한다


              def GotoDoorForm():
              #DoorForm  으로 가는함수


                      mv_DoorForm = DoorForm()
                      #DoorForm  을 선언한뒤


                      mv_DoorForm.showFullScreen()
                      # 최대화면으로 출력한다


              class Worker(QObject):
              #nfc  입력을 받는 클래스


                      finished = pyqtSignal()
                      #Signal 을 통해 finished  를 정의한다


                      nfcTag = pyqtSignal()
                      #Signal 을 통해 nfcTag   를 정의한다




                      def getserial(self):
                      # 시리얼 통신으로 nfc       입력을 받는 메쏘드


                              flag_t=open("nfc_flag.txt",'r')
                              #nfc  입력을 받을지 말지 결정하는 텍스트 파일 염


                              flag=flag_t.read()
                              #flag  변수를 통해 값을 받아온다


                              while flag=='1':
                              #flag 가 1 일 때까지 허용될 때까지(        )


                                      flag_t=open("nfc_flag.txt",'r')
                                      #nfc  입력을 받을지 말지 결정하는 텍스트 파일 염


                                      flag=flag_t.read()
                                      #flag  변수를 통해 값을 받아온다


                                      if flag=='1':
                                      #nfc  입력이 허용될 경우


                                                          - 663 -
   658   659   660   661   662   663   664   665   666   667   668